Hello,

 

I forgot to "Sort master", at the end of Finishing Line > Loot. I did everything that comes after, and my game now CTD before loading the main menu.

 

I identified one culprit ESP as being "Weather Systems Merged.esp".

 

Do I have to start over from Finishing Line > Loot? If so, are there some subchapters I can skip (like generation with xLODGEN and DynDOLOD)?

 

Thanks for your help.

A crash to desktop before the main menu is generally an indication of a missing master error. If this is the case, the Weather Systems merged file will have a red triangle next to it (and an indication in the top right corner of MO, for that matter). Hovering your mouse over that triangle should identify the file that is missing - turn this on. As to what portions of the finishing line you need to redo, I'd suggest the Great Equalizer, Wrye Bash Patch, Smash Patch and zPatch. The LOD portions should only be redone if the missing master has anything to do with terrain, and given that it's the weather systems that caused the original problem, that may be needed as well.

 

The Sorting Masters thing... great if you do it, but I've never seen any adverse affects from not doing it. Since you'll likely have to redo a bunch of stuff, may as well this time around, but if you don't I wouldn't sweat it too much.

 

As to the SkyUI problem, if you go through the list for MCM config, you'll note Lexy has you turn off most (and in my case, I turn off all) of the options for version monitoring. It's not a serious error, and nothing to worry about, but this way you don't get informed about it every time you load up the game.
